Default cracked my fuel rail

Well not quite one of the rails themselves, but rather where the scrader valve is on the pipe on the back. I had to pull the sender unit for the electric fuel pressure gauge I installed back off to pull the schrader valve out, yeah well it bent it and it cracked.
I did manage to find someone who would finally weld it, yeah it still leaks, but its a lot less than it was. So tommarow I am going to try to JB Weld up the last little hole. If this dosen't work anyone have a spare fuel rail laying around?

Go figure, every single part on the fuel rail is replaceable, except for that one part, you have to order the whole right side of the rail to get that back tube that the schrader valve is attached to.
